
【計】 floating-point rounding
【計】 floating point; FP
【計】 half-adjust; round-off; rounding; rounding off
浮點舍入(Floating-Point Rounding)是計算機科學中處理實數近似表示的核心機制,指将無法精确表示的數值調整為最接近的可存儲浮點格式的操作。該過程受IEEE 754标準嚴格規範,主要包含五種模式:
向最近偶數舍入(Round to Nearest, Ties to Even):默認模式,優先選擇最低有效位為偶數的近似值,有效降低統計偏差,被Intel處理器等硬件廣泛采用。
定向舍入:
截斷舍入(Truncation):保留指定位數後直接舍棄尾數,常見于早期計算機系統。
在航天器軌道計算等科學計算領域,舍入誤差的累積可能引發蝴蝶效應,NASA JPL實驗室因此特别要求采用擴展精度浮點運算。金融系統則需遵守ISO/IEC 10967标準,通過控制舍入方向保障交易公平性。
浮點舍入(Floating-Point Rounding)是計算機處理實數時,将無法精确表示的數值調整為最接近的可存儲浮點數的過程。由于浮點數在計算機中的存儲空間有限(如單精度32位、雙精度64位),許多實數無法被精确表示,因此必須通過舍入來近似。
浮點數表示原理
浮點數基于IEEE 754标準,由三部分構成:
舍入模式
常見的舍入方式包括:
舍入誤差來源
round(2.5)
在Python中返回2(若用銀行家舍入法),但部分語言可能返回3,取決于實現。decimal
模塊)替代浮點數。abs(a - b) < 1e-9
)。浮點舍入是數值計算中的基礎問題,正确處理可避免隱蔽的邏輯錯誤。
保存附件被囊纖維素不可重複的布魯赫氏腺差錯待查摻镧锆钛酸鉛顫振單分子反應淡黃色奈瑟氏菌膽囊空腸吻合術發行優先股防拷貝蓋氏腺甘心供應價格詭論的國内分行骨相學貨物預先申報金屬氧化鋁氧化矽半導體存儲器闊韌帶妊娠藍天法哩路道視網膜檢影法雙核目水套縮影膠片閱讀器特勞伯氏征外彙穩定基金